ホームページ >バックエンド開発 >PHPチュートリアル >PHP で多次元配列に null 値が含まれているかどうかを確認する方法
助けて!上の図に示すように、列に null 値が含まれている限り、この列は除外されます。 ?
rreee
null 値が見つかった場合は、最初に行 = null を設定し、それから設定を解除します
上記で表現したいのは 3 階です。例! 2 番目のキーの値だけを保持します。それらはすべて値を持っているため、それを実装する方法
)
rreee
$arr=array( 'listid'=>array('',5), 'title'=>array('',38), 'type'=>array('','我有'), 'count'=>array('',3), 'content'=>array('无','无'));foreach($arr as $k=>$v){ if(is_array($v)){ foreach($v as $v2){ if($v2==''){ unset($arr[$k]); } } }}echo "<pre class="brush:php;toolbar:false">";print_r($arr);echo "";/*Array( [content] => Array ( [0] => 无 [1] => 无 ))*/望ましい結果が得られました これで、$arr に完全な値のセットが含まれていない場合、エラーが発生します
ありがとうございます、解決されました